Lab Testing: What You Need To Know - Dr. Jamie Gilliam
In this Heal Your Body episode, Dr. Jamie Gilliam deep dives into lab testing and provides a comprehensive presentation that sheds light on the world of laboratory tests. Gain clarity on which tests are necessary, the difference between optimal and normal lab ranges, and the interconnectedness of different lab values.
She begins by exploring the importance of comprehensive lab testing in healthcare, emphasizing how these tests offer crucial insights into your health status, aiding in diagnosis, monitoring, and treatment decisions. If you've been told, "Your labs are normal," the first question to ask is, "What lab tests were ordered?" Dr. Jamie also explains how initial comprehensive lab results can indicate the need for further diagnostic testing or a referral to the appropriate specialty care provider.
A key focus of this episode is the concept of optimal vs. normal (allopathic) lab ranges. While normal ranges are said to indicate typical values seen in a healthy population, these ranges are often too broad. A patient can be symptomatic with lab values within a broad lab range, while another is asymptomatic. Optimal ranges are more narrow than normal lab ranges, which reflect optimal health. Understanding these distinctions can help you and your healthcare provider identify potential health issues early and also can aid in properly diagnosing existing conditions.
Dr. Jamie also explores the connections between various lab values, illustrating how one value can influence or be influenced by another. She explains the importance of evaluating labs as a whole instead of evaluating each lab value independently. For example, she discusses how LDL cholesterol levels are associated with thyroid hormone levels and many other levels within your lab results, yet many providers do not acknowledge the connection. Understanding these interconnections provides an in-depth view of how the 12 body systems are functioning independently and together, which allows for targeted interventions to optimize health outcomes.
